a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Nicolin Chen <b42378@freescale.com>2013-11-13 09:55:27 -0500
committerVinod Koul <vinod.koul@intel.com>2013-12-15 22:48:48 -0500
commitb1d27c79c8377df1880447375deffa3bb82c7bd3 (patch)
treefd02c50f4c51f024de2cefbe38f435a247e10470
parent1a895578d4e50577bb6aa79bd194b502f09dd768 (diff)
ARM: dts: imx: use dual-fifo sdma script for ssi
Use dual-fifo sdma scripts instead of shared scripts for ssi on i.MX series. Signed-off-by: Nicolin Chen <b42378@freescale.com> Acked-by: Shawn Guo <shawn.guo@linaro.org> Signed-off-by: Vinod Koul <vinod.koul@intel.com>
-rw-r--r--arch/arm/boot/dts/imx51.dtsi4
-rw-r--r--arch/arm/boot/dts/imx53.dtsi4
-rw-r--r--arch/arm/boot/dts/imx6qdl.dtsi12
-rw-r--r--arch/arm/boot/dts/imx6sl.dtsi12
4 files changed, 16 insertions, 16 deletions
diff --git a/arch/arm/boot/dts/imx51.dtsi b/arch/arm/boot/dts/imx51.dtsi
index 4bcdd3ad15e5..5be28377d41f 100644
--- a/arch/arm/boot/dts/imx51.dtsi
+++ b/arch/arm/boot/dts/imx51.dtsi
@@ -159,8 +159,8 @@
159 reg = <0x70014000 0x4000>; 159 reg = <0x70014000 0x4000>;
160 interrupts = <30>; 160 interrupts = <30>;
161 clocks = <&clks 49>; 161 clocks = <&clks 49>;
162 dmas = <&sdma 24 1 0>, 162 dmas = <&sdma 24 22 0>,
163 <&sdma 25 1 0>; 163 <&sdma 25 22 0>;
164 dma-names = "rx", "tx"; 164 dma-names = "rx", "tx";
165 fsl,fifo-depth = <15>; 165 fsl,fifo-depth = <15>;
166 fsl,ssi-dma-events = <25 24 23 22>; /* TX0 RX0 TX1 RX1 */ 166 fsl,ssi-dma-events = <25 24 23 22>; /* TX0 RX0 TX1 RX1 */
diff --git a/arch/arm/boot/dts/imx53.dtsi b/arch/arm/boot/dts/imx53.dtsi
index 4307e80b2d2e..7208fde9bc16 100644
--- a/arch/arm/boot/dts/imx53.dtsi
+++ b/arch/arm/boot/dts/imx53.dtsi
@@ -153,8 +153,8 @@
153 reg = <0x50014000 0x4000>; 153 reg = <0x50014000 0x4000>;
154 interrupts = <30>; 154 interrupts = <30>;
155 clocks = <&clks 49>; 155 clocks = <&clks 49>;
156 dmas = <&sdma 24 1 0>, 156 dmas = <&sdma 24 22 0>,
157 <&sdma 25 1 0>; 157 <&sdma 25 22 0>;
158 dma-names = "rx", "tx"; 158 dma-names = "rx", "tx";
159 fsl,fifo-depth = <15>; 159 fsl,fifo-depth = <15>;
160 fsl,ssi-dma-events = <25 24 23 22>; /* TX0 RX0 TX1 RX1 */ 160 fsl,ssi-dma-events = <25 24 23 22>; /* TX0 RX0 TX1 RX1 */
diff --git a/arch/arm/boot/dts/imx6qdl.dtsi b/arch/arm/boot/dts/imx6qdl.dtsi
index fb28b2ecb1db..e9534f2f53e7 100644
--- a/arch/arm/boot/dts/imx6qdl.dtsi
+++ b/arch/arm/boot/dts/imx6qdl.dtsi
@@ -236,8 +236,8 @@
236 reg = <0x02028000 0x4000>; 236 reg = <0x02028000 0x4000>;
237 interrupts = <0 46 0x04>; 237 interrupts = <0 46 0x04>;
238 clocks = <&clks 178>; 238 clocks = <&clks 178>;
239 dmas = <&sdma 37 1 0>, 239 dmas = <&sdma 37 22 0>,
240 <&sdma 38 1 0>; 240 <&sdma 38 22 0>;
241 dma-names = "rx", "tx"; 241 dma-names = "rx", "tx";
242 fsl,fifo-depth = <15>; 242 fsl,fifo-depth = <15>;
243 fsl,ssi-dma-events = <38 37>; 243 fsl,ssi-dma-events = <38 37>;
@@ -249,8 +249,8 @@
249 reg = <0x0202c000 0x4000>; 249 reg = <0x0202c000 0x4000>;
250 interrupts = <0 47 0x04>; 250 interrupts = <0 47 0x04>;
251 clocks = <&clks 179>; 251 clocks = <&clks 179>;
252 dmas = <&sdma 41 1 0>, 252 dmas = <&sdma 41 22 0>,
253 <&sdma 42 1 0>; 253 <&sdma 42 22 0>;
254 dma-names = "rx", "tx"; 254 dma-names = "rx", "tx";
255 fsl,fifo-depth = <15>; 255 fsl,fifo-depth = <15>;
256 fsl,ssi-dma-events = <42 41>; 256 fsl,ssi-dma-events = <42 41>;
@@ -262,8 +262,8 @@
262 reg = <0x02030000 0x4000>; 262 reg = <0x02030000 0x4000>;
263 interrupts = <0 48 0x04>; 263 interrupts = <0 48 0x04>;
264 clocks = <&clks 180>; 264 clocks = <&clks 180>;
265 dmas = <&sdma 45 1 0>, 265 dmas = <&sdma 45 22 0>,
266 <&sdma 46 1 0>; 266 <&sdma 46 22 0>;
267 dma-names = "rx", "tx"; 267 dma-names = "rx", "tx";
268 fsl,fifo-depth = <15>; 268 fsl,fifo-depth = <15>;
269 fsl,ssi-dma-events = <46 45>; 269 fsl,ssi-dma-events = <46 45>;
diff --git a/arch/arm/boot/dts/imx6sl.dtsi b/arch/arm/boot/dts/imx6sl.dtsi
index 28558f1aaf2d..7b57fecd0bd5 100644
--- a/arch/arm/boot/dts/imx6sl.dtsi
+++ b/arch/arm/boot/dts/imx6sl.dtsi
@@ -199,8 +199,8 @@
199 reg = <0x02028000 0x4000>; 199 reg = <0x02028000 0x4000>;
200 interrupts = <0 46 0x04>; 200 interrupts = <0 46 0x04>;
201 clocks = <&clks IMX6SL_CLK_SSI1>; 201 clocks = <&clks IMX6SL_CLK_SSI1>;
202 dmas = <&sdma 37 1 0>, 202 dmas = <&sdma 37 22 0>,
203 <&sdma 38 1 0>; 203 <&sdma 38 22 0>;
204 dma-names = "rx", "tx"; 204 dma-names = "rx", "tx";
205 fsl,fifo-depth = <15>; 205 fsl,fifo-depth = <15>;
206 status = "disabled"; 206 status = "disabled";
@@ -211,8 +211,8 @@
211 reg = <0x0202c000 0x4000>; 211 reg = <0x0202c000 0x4000>;
212 interrupts = <0 47 0x04>; 212 interrupts = <0 47 0x04>;
213 clocks = <&clks IMX6SL_CLK_SSI2>; 213 clocks = <&clks IMX6SL_CLK_SSI2>;
214 dmas = <&sdma 41 1 0>, 214 dmas = <&sdma 41 22 0>,
215 <&sdma 42 1 0>; 215 <&sdma 42 22 0>;
216 dma-names = "rx", "tx"; 216 dma-names = "rx", "tx";
217 fsl,fifo-depth = <15>; 217 fsl,fifo-depth = <15>;
218 status = "disabled"; 218 status = "disabled";
@@ -223,8 +223,8 @@
223 reg = <0x02030000 0x4000>; 223 reg = <0x02030000 0x4000>;
224 interrupts = <0 48 0x04>; 224 interrupts = <0 48 0x04>;
225 clocks = <&clks IMX6SL_CLK_SSI3>; 225 clocks = <&clks IMX6SL_CLK_SSI3>;
226 dmas = <&sdma 45 1 0>, 226 dmas = <&sdma 45 22 0>,
227 <&sdma 46 1 0>; 227 <&sdma 46 22 0>;
228 dma-names = "rx", "tx"; 228 dma-names = "rx", "tx";
229 fsl,fifo-depth = <15>; 229 fsl,fifo-depth = <15>;
230 status = "disabled"; 230 status = "disabled";